CC   -!- FUNCTION: Fluoride-specific ion channel. Important for reducing
CC       fluoride concentration in the cell, thus reducing its toxicity.
CC       {ECO:0000256|HAMAP-Rule:MF_00454}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=fluoride(in) = fluoride(out); Xref=Rhea:RHEA:76159,
CC         ChEBI:CHEBI:17051; Evidence={ECO:0000256|ARBA:ARBA00035585};
CC       PhysiologicalDirection=left-to-right; Xref=Rhea:RHEA:76160;
CC         Evidence={ECO:0000256|ARBA:ARBA00035585};
CC   -!- ACTIVITY REGULATION: Na(+) is not transported, but it plays an
CC       essential structural role and its presence is essential for fluoride
CC       channel function. {ECO:0000256|HAMAP-Rule:MF_00454}.
